142: Chapter 45: Curse·Love·Heart 142: Chapter 45: Curse·Love·Heart “Boss, emergency treatment is done, please try not to engage in any strenuous activities…”

“Boss, the Red Lion and that guy are almost here, should we first…”

The leader held his neck, taking heavy breaths.

“Everyone else retreat, leave only the feathers.”

The leader sat on the chair, seemingly not preparing to move in the least.

The safe house was silent, the subordinates who were just talking incessantly were now silent.

A quiet, short person walked up to the side of the leader of Wing of Death, bowed, and said.

“Mr.

Leader, you now have only five feathers that can fight.

I think I should also—”

“Triple the commission, it’s already in your account.”

He gasped for air, his words still strong, allowing no one to refuse.

Everyone in the room had just witnessed the pitiful state of their leader, but no one thought he had weakened.

Sitting in the chair, his clothes soaked with sweat, his body occasionally trembling with weakness.

But the eyes under the skull mask were still fierce, like a lone wolf driven to desperation.

This man had wings woven from fear and loyalty on his back, no matter how heavily wounded, the black wings would not fall but would only be dyed bright red with blood.

The leader’s subordinates nodded silently and complied with his order.

He struggled to stand up, raising his right arm, the mechanical limb as shiny as new.

“The last fight.”

Kardesia looked out the window, as if asking unintentionally.

“Lianyi, did you forget everything about today when you treated your wounds?”

“A day’s memory refers to the quantity of memory of a day.

Compared to a day’s memory, the memory of the day is a heavier price, because if the memory of the day is used as the price, the state of the mind will revert directly to the same time yesterday.

Just looking at the result, it would put me in an extremely unfavorable situation.”

Which day’s memory was it?

He thought Kardesia would continue to inquire to the end.

In fact, memories that could be used as a price for treatment were all cherished memories.

Specifically, they were his memories after escaping the Shiyu Research Institute and coming to the city in the sky.

Curses are a technique of harm; one could exchange pain for the agony of others.

But if one wanted to use this power to heal or retrieve something, one also had to sacrifice something they cherished.

Otherwise, the scales could not balance.

“I see.”

But the girl did not inquire further.

She put on her dried hat, pointing towards a building not far away.

“We’re here.”

Red Meteor transformed from a robot back into a car, stopping in front of a dark building.

Perhaps sensing that sending more subordinates was meaningless, or maybe because the manpower of Wing of Death had taken heavy hits in the continuous battles, there was no one to stop them in front of the safe house where the leader was.

The open door seemed to be silently inviting the two of them.

Shiyu Lianyi was the first to get out of the car.

“Kardesia, how many people do you think are still there?”

The blonde girl declined the driver’s suggestion to treat her injuries and turned half of her body into flames to suppress her condition.

The light spots on her right arm stopped spreading and even began to fade visibly, indicating she was finally nearing the limit of the duration of her “Death Charge” ability.

“The Wing of Death isn’t what it used to be.

Their most elite have been wiped out by me, and the riffraff were almost all dealt with on our way here.

The number of fighters by the leader…

probably five or six?”

There was at least one Spiritual Image Mage capable of creating large-scale illusions.

He must be a high-level Divine Communication, but not in the Manifestation Realm, as the leader wouldn’t be able to afford that cost.

Shiyu Lianyi preemptively took off his gloves, trying one last time to persuade.

“Kardesia—”

The woman with the top hat didn’t give him a chance, her words were decisive and refused any rebuttal, just like her usual whimsical self.

“I’m going with you.”

The man in the suit could only smile bitterly, “Promise me, don’t get hurt again.”

Kardesia nodded excitedly, he sincerely hoped she would take his advice to heart.

Frankly, Kardesia’s psychological pressure on him was several times greater than that of the leader and Wing of Death combined.

He had never carried out such a difficult mission before, never…

only a morning date came close to the current situation.

It was also a date now, and thinking of this, he felt even more pressure.

Shiyu Lianyi preemptively took off his gloves.

He cut his palm with his fingertip, using the scarred back of his hand as a canvas to trace intricate patterns.

The complex design took shape quickly, flawless.

His hands fluttered like butterflies, revealing the complete pattern drawn on the back of his hand.

What emerged above the young man’s hands was none other than a blood-red scale.

Shiyu Lianyi declared softly.

“Polluted Song Curse Body, commanding with intent.”

“Curse Scale·Manifestation—”

Shiyu Research Institute’s most vicious and malevolent subject now completely revealed his psyche.

A giant human figure emerged behind the young man, the Xu Ying wrapped in a veil-like cloak, with nothing but endless darkness visible under the sleeves and hood, with no discernible features.

A scale as wide as the white figure floated in front of it, one side golden, the other dark, the true embodiment of Shiyu Lianyi’s Impermanence Skill.

“Curse Scale of Polluted Clouds.”

He began the initial transaction.

“The price is immobility ten minutes later, the return is an enhancement in physical ability for ten minutes.”

The scale tilted slightly towards the golden side.

Time was abundant, should there be need, another transaction of the same type could be performed.

Shiyu Lianyi drew his handgun, switched off the safety, and walked toward the building with an unchanging expression.

As he stepped into the safe house, soft sounds came from both sides, bullets from silenced guns aimed at his head!

Immediately after, a burly man with a club swung at him from the front!
